Lockheed Martin is designing, developing, and delivering a next-gen wideband MILSATCOM system comprised of integrated space and ground segments that will provide enhanced communications capacity, flexibility and resiliency. This position will be a key member of the Systems Engineering, Integration and Test (SEIT) team in support of the final design, development, production, integration, test, and delivery of this critical capability focused on the requirements development, decomposition, and verification.

In this role, you will:
- Perform Requirements and Verification Engineering for the next-gen wideband MILSATCOM system. This includes leading efforts to:
- Develop, allocate, flow-down both performance and functional requirements from the system to its constituent segments and elements
- Coordinate closely across the SEIT team and with lower-tier systems, hardware, and software engineers to ensure a comprehensive allocation and understanding of the system requirements
- Develop verification and validation plans; lead the applicable verification and validation activities ensuring the systems both meets requirements and performs as needed
- Support/lead key program design reviews
